Architecture of Observation Towers

It seems to be human nature to enjoy a view, getting the higher ground and taking in our surroundings has become a significant aspect of architecture across the world. Observation towers which allow visitors to climb and observe their surroundings, provide a chance to take in the beauty of the land while at the same time adding something unique and impressive to the landscape.

Model Making In Architecture

The importance of model making in architecture could be thought to have reduced in recent years. With the introduction of new and innovative architecture design technology, is there still a place for model making in architecture? Stanton Williams, director at Stirling Prize-winning practice, Gavin Henderson, believes that it’s more important than ever.

Railroad Injuries Settlement

If you are a railroad employee and were injured on the job you could be entitled to compensation. This could include loss of wages, future and past medical expenses including pain and suffering as well as permanent or partial disability.

These cases can be extremely high-risk and are typically handled by attorneys who specialize in railroad insurance claims. An experienced attorney can advise you on whether filing a lawsuit in federal or state court may be advantageous to you, depending on your case.

In railroad work, there are a variety of injuries that can arise from an accident at work. These can include loss of limb, crushing injuries, burns, brain trauma, electric shocks, fractured bones, severe lacerations and many others. FELA provides both wage and medical benefits to injured workers. However, a railroad employee must prove that their injury was caused by negligence of their employer in order to receive compensation.

Disputes between danville railroad crossing accident attorneys employees and their employers are covered by the Federal Employers Liability Act (FELA). This law gives railroad workers who are injured while working in the railyard or on other railroad property a right seek compensation for their injuries. This includes lost wages and medical expenses and benefits as well as pain and suffering.

Mediation

Mediation is the process by which disputants attempt to settle their disagreement with the help of an impartial third party. Mediation is less costly and more effective than litigation and gives litigants a voice settlement decisions.

The mediator can also assist parties by providing relationship-building and procedural assistance. These services typically result in better communication and the negotiation of a better deal.
